Developments in Robotics
One significant improvement in dental surgery is making use of robotic innovation, which allows for accurate and effective procedures. With the help of robotic systems, dental cosmetic surgeons have the ability to carry out complex surgical procedures with boosted precision, minimizing the threat of human error.
These robotic systems are geared up with advanced imaging innovation and specific instruments that allow cosmetic surgeons to browse via elaborate physiological structures with ease. By utilizing robot modern technology, specialists can achieve greater surgical precision, causing boosted individual end results and faster recuperation times.
Additionally, making use of robotics in dental surgery enables minimally invasive procedures, decreasing the injury to surrounding cells and advertising faster recovery.

Minimally Invasive Strategies
To further progress the field of oral surgery, accept the potential of minimally intrusive methods that can significantly benefit both surgeons and clients alike.
Minimally invasive methods are reinventing the area by decreasing medical trauma, reducing post-operative discomfort, and speeding up the recuperation process. These methods include using smaller sized lacerations and specialized tools to execute procedures with precision and efficiency.
By making use of innovative imaging modern technology, such as cone light beam calculated tomography (CBCT), cosmetic surgeons can properly prepare and carry out surgical procedures with very little invasiveness.
Furthermore, the use of lasers in dental surgery permits specific tissue cutting and coagulation, resulting in minimized bleeding and decreased recovery time.
With minimally intrusive methods, patients can experience much faster recuperation, lowered scarring, and boosted end results, making it a vital facet of the future of oral surgery.
